Eye health supplements are popular because they offer a simple way to add vision-focused nutrients to a daily wellness routine. They are not medical treatments and do not cure eye disease, but a well-designed formula may help support the nutritional foundation your eyes need.
Many adults spend hours on phones, computers, and tablets. A quality eye-health routine may support visual comfort and antioxidant protection when paired with screen breaks and healthy habits.
Ingredients such as lutein and zeaxanthin are commonly used because they are naturally concentrated in the macula and associated with light-filtering and antioxidant activity.
Vitamins, minerals, carotenoids, and plant compounds can help support a vision-focused nutrition routine.

Common eye-health supplement ingredients include carotenoids such as lutein and zeaxanthin, antioxidant vitamins, minerals such as zinc and copper, and plant antioxidants. Review dosage, label transparency, cautions, and ingredient overlap with other supplements.
